What it does

The objectives of the Society are to promote and advance the study, control and prevention of diseases in humans and other animals in the tropics and sub-tropics, facilitate discussion and exchange of information among those who are interested in tropical diseases and international health, and generally to promote the work of those interested in these objectives.
